This is an observational analytical study of prevalent cases and controls.
Approximately 39 subjects who practice CrossFit at least 6 hours a week are invitated to participate in this observational study. It will measure the activation of trapezius and Serratus muscles by Electromyography experiencing a feeling of fatigue 7-8 in PushPress and PullUps.
